Health Benefits of Using HPMC in Low-Fat and Diet Foods
Hydroxypropyl methylcellulose (HPMC) is a versatile ingredient that has found its way into a wide range of food products, particularly low-fat and diet foods. This cellulose derivative is commonly used as a thickener, stabilizer, and emulsifier in various food applications. Its unique properties make it an ideal choice for manufacturers looking to create healthier alternatives to traditional high-fat and calorie-laden products.
One of the key health benefits of using HPMC in low-fat and diet foods is its ability to mimic the texture and mouthfeel of fat. Fat plays a crucial role in the sensory experience of food, providing a creamy and rich sensation that is often difficult to replicate in low-fat products. By incorporating HPMC into their formulations, manufacturers can achieve a similar mouthfeel without the need for high levels of fat. This allows consumers to enjoy the taste and texture they love without compromising on their dietary goals.
In addition to its textural benefits, HPMC also helps improve the stability and shelf life of low-fat and diet foods. Fat serves as a natural preservative in many food products, helping to prevent spoilage and extend the product’s lifespan. However, in low-fat formulations, this protective barrier is often lacking. HPMC can help fill this gap by providing a protective coating that helps prevent oxidation and microbial growth. This not only extends the shelf life of the product but also ensures that it maintains its quality and freshness over time.
Furthermore, HPMC is a non-caloric ingredient, making it an attractive option for manufacturers looking to reduce the calorie content of their products. By replacing high-calorie ingredients such as fats and sugars with HPMC, manufacturers can create low-fat and diet foods that are lower in calories without sacrificing taste or texture. This makes it easier for consumers to make healthier choices without feeling like they are missing out on their favorite foods.
Another health benefit of using HPMC in low-fat and diet foods is its ability to improve satiety and promote weight management. HPMC is a soluble fiber that forms a gel-like substance in the digestive tract, which helps slow down the absorption of nutrients and promotes a feeling of fullness. This can help reduce overall calorie intake and prevent overeating, making it easier for individuals to maintain a healthy weight. By incorporating HPMC into their products, manufacturers can help consumers feel satisfied and satiated while still enjoying delicious and nutritious foods.

Formulation Tips for Incorporating HPMC in Low-Fat and Diet Foods
Hydroxypropyl methylcellulose (HPMC) is a versatile ingredient that has found widespread applications in the food industry. One area where HPMC has proven to be particularly useful is in the formulation of low-fat and diet foods. In this article, we will explore the various ways in which HPMC can be incorporated into these types of products, as well as some tips for formulating with this ingredient.
One of the key benefits of using HPMC in low-fat and diet foods is its ability to mimic the texture and mouthfeel of fats. Fats play a crucial role in the sensory experience of food, providing richness and creaminess that are often lacking in low-fat and diet products. By using HPMC, formulators can create products that have a similar mouthfeel to their full-fat counterparts, helping to improve consumer acceptance and satisfaction.
In addition to its textural benefits, HPMC also acts as a stabilizer and thickener in low-fat and diet foods. This can be particularly useful in products such as dressings, sauces, and soups, where fats are traditionally used to provide stability and viscosity. By incorporating HPMC into these formulations, formulators can achieve the desired texture and consistency without the need for high levels of fat.
When formulating with HPMC, it is important to consider the type and grade of the ingredient being used. HPMC is available in a range of viscosities and particle sizes, which can impact its functionality in different applications. For example, high-viscosity HPMC is often used in products that require a thick, creamy texture, while low-viscosity HPMC may be more suitable for applications where a thinner consistency is desired.
Another important consideration when formulating with HPMC is its hydration properties. HPMC is a hydrophilic polymer, meaning that it has a strong affinity for water. This can be both a benefit and a challenge when formulating low-fat and diet foods. On the one hand, HPMC can help to improve the moisture retention and shelf life of these products. On the other hand, it can also lead to issues such as gelation or syneresis if not properly managed.
To avoid these potential pitfalls, formulators should carefully control the hydration of HPMC in their formulations. This can be achieved by pre-hydrating the ingredient before adding it to the rest of the formulation, or by adjusting the water content of the recipe to account for the water-binding properties of HPMC. By taking these steps, formulators can ensure that HPMC performs optimally in their low-fat and diet foods.
